Many companies, at present, are struggling with challenges in their supply chain, including but not limited to high costs, compliance issues, and lack of transparency and visibility in the entire process.

Business owners have a lot on their plates- this is where freight forwarding acts as a boon. The services range from manufacturing to customer or retailer delivery, whether on a national or international level.

freight forwarding companies can step in to manage the transportation of large shipments on behalf of their clients, which can include suppliers, carriers, and logistic providers. They plan and coordinate all aspects of the shipment’s journey.

A common misconception is that freight forwarders only pick up and deliver stock to its final destination. However, their job is much more complex as the process requires a significant amount of paperwork due to various trade regulations. In addition, freight forwarders can provide you with helpful advice regarding which mode of shipment would be best for your corporation.

A freight forwarder has become a popular solution for many companies looking to overcome supply chain challenges. This is due in large part to their ability to find creative solutions outside the box.
